diff options
author | Carbenium <carbenium@outlook.com> | 2020-08-19 00:25:36 +0200 |
---|---|---|
committer | Carbenium <carbenium@outlook.com> | 2020-08-19 00:29:31 +0200 |
commit | 515a34f64f200ea0fb9722914b76ab8abd358891 (patch) | |
tree | 50748ff657ef983e5f549cfc6df45d1f0495e598 /src | |
parent | f04f4e91ff3afbf89f30659b85e8593c3206138e (diff) |
Scripts/Commands: Convert argument parsing of honor commands to new system
Diffstat (limited to 'src')
-rw-r--r-- | src/server/scripts/Commands/cs_honor.cpp | 10 |
1 files changed, 3 insertions, 7 deletions
diff --git a/src/server/scripts/Commands/cs_honor.cpp b/src/server/scripts/Commands/cs_honor.cpp index 698b6f14580..95f7834bd1e 100644 --- a/src/server/scripts/Commands/cs_honor.cpp +++ b/src/server/scripts/Commands/cs_honor.cpp @@ -55,11 +55,8 @@ public: return commandTable; } - static bool HandleHonorAddCommand(ChatHandler* handler, char const* args) + static bool HandleHonorAddCommand(ChatHandler* handler, uint32 amount) { - if (!*args) - return false; - Player* target = handler->getSelectedPlayer(); if (!target) { @@ -72,12 +69,11 @@ public: if (handler->HasLowerSecurity(target, ObjectGuid::Empty)) return false; - uint32 amount = (uint32)atoi(args); target->RewardHonor(nullptr, 1, amount); return true; } - static bool HandleHonorAddKillCommand(ChatHandler* handler, char const* /*args*/) + static bool HandleHonorAddKillCommand(ChatHandler* handler) { Unit* target = handler->getSelectedUnit(); if (!target) @@ -96,7 +92,7 @@ public: return true; } - static bool HandleHonorUpdateCommand(ChatHandler* handler, char const* /*args*/) + static bool HandleHonorUpdateCommand(ChatHandler* handler) { Player* target = handler->getSelectedPlayer(); if (!target) |